Manuel Rego Casasnovas
d358e8dab9
ItEr18S14CUAsignacionRecursosEspecificosAPlanificacion: Implemented functionallity to assign resources to a task from the Scheduleing view.
2009-07-27 19:56:51 +02:00
Susana Montes Pedreira
886a15e3d9
ItEr18S04ArquitecturaServidorItEr17S04: Configuration and creation of PlannerDaoRegistry, OrdersDaoRegistry and WorkReportDaoRegistry.
2009-07-27 19:25:47 +02:00
Susana Montes Pedreira
664bf0c718
ItEr18S12CUListaPartesTraballoDendeOrganizacionTraballoItEr17S17: Show the asigned hours to the order elements.
...
Javier Moran Rua <jmoran@igalia.com>: Several changes to adapt the code to the formatting conventions.
2009-07-27 19:11:01 +02:00
Xavier Castaño García
825f533283
ItEr18S07RFComportamentoGraficoPlanificadorItEr17S07: Removed duplicated YUI import.
2009-07-26 17:14:14 +02:00
Manuel Rego Casasnovas
26582213af
ItEr18S14CUAsignacionRecursosEspecificosAPlanificacion: Added a generic DAO for ResourceAllocation.
2009-07-24 19:13:10 +02:00
Manuel Rego Casasnovas
657e0429f3
ItEr18S14CUAsignacionRecursosEspecificosAPlanificacion: Added basic unit tests to add and remove a ResourceAllocation.
2009-07-24 18:57:42 +02:00
Manuel Rego Casasnovas
5861e44f1a
ItEr18S14CUAsignacionRecursosEspecificosAPlanificacion: Created business entities ResourceAllocation and SpecificResourceAllocation. Made relations with Task and Worker.
...
Javier Moran Rua <jmoran@igalia.com>: The commit has been ammended adding the ResourceAllocation entity to the
navalplanner-business-spring-config-test.xml configuration file.
2009-07-24 18:50:49 +02:00
Manuel Rego Casasnovas
f73c6a1d9c
ItEr18S14CUAsignacionRecursosEspecificosAPlanificacion: Added a new method "buildAnd" to CriterionCompounder that receives a List of ICriterion.
...
Javier Moran Rua <jmoran@igalia.com>: The commit has been ammended to include a missing static import in
CriterionTest.
2009-07-24 18:20:36 +02:00
Fernando Bellas Permuy
09e65ab582
ItEr18S04ArquitecturaServidorItEr17S04: IGenericDao::findExistingEntity + several minor improvements.
...
The method IGenericDao::findExistingEntity has been added. Unlike IGenericDao::find, it returns a runtime exception if the entity does not exist. So, this method should be used when the entity with the key passed as a parameter is supposed to exist. This patch also fixes some methods in GenericDaoHibernate which were not using try-catch to convert Hibernate exceptions to the Spring exception hierarchy.
2009-07-24 16:53:27 +02:00
Manuel Rego Casasnovas
a7aa2bed5c
ItEr18S14CUAsignacionRecursosEspecificosAPlanificacion: Added findUniqueByNif method to Woker DAO.
2009-07-24 13:27:45 +02:00
Óscar González Fernández
004ce99e6f
ItEr18S08CUCreacionProxectoPlanificacionItEr17S10: Adding remove task as command.
2009-07-24 13:08:19 +02:00
Óscar González Fernández
454578cd12
ItEr18S08CUCreacionProxectoPlanificacionItEr17S10: Adding contextualized commands support.
2009-07-24 12:58:20 +02:00
Óscar González Fernández
a863ae31df
ItEr18S08CUCreacionProxectoPlanificacionItEr17S10: Adding method reload. It reloads all the planner from a new set of data.
...
It makes easier the importation.
2009-07-24 10:22:19 +02:00
Susana Montes Pedreira
fbcd35beff
ItEr18S09CUAltaTipoParteDeTraballoItEr17S12: Modify WorkReports entities
2009-07-22 22:09:53 +02:00
Susana Montes Pedreira
4059f70b02
ItEr18S13CreacionDeOrganizacionsDeTraballoItEr17S09: validate code the sons of each order element and append the name of the orderline to the message of error
2009-07-22 21:52:36 +02:00
Óscar González Fernández
7e0241a15c
ItEr18S08CUCreacionProxectoPlanificacionItEr17S10: When adding the first dependency, it wasn't added as a child of listdependencies. Fixing it.
2009-07-22 21:17:47 +02:00
Susana Montes Pedreira
7d41241bf2
ItEr17S09CUCreacionDeOrganizacionsDeTraballoItEr16S11: Changing the list of items of orders for inclusion of a field code.
2009-07-20 21:47:36 +02:00
Óscar González Fernández
b44346d3aa
ItEr18S08CUCreacionProxectoPlanificacionItEr17S10: When removeDependency is called, the dependency is removed.
2009-07-20 21:34:39 +02:00
Óscar González Fernández
e7dce15cb3
ItEr18S08CUCreacionProxectoPlanificacionItEr17S10: Adding method in IAdapterToTaskFundamentalProperties to be called when removing dependency.
2009-07-20 21:34:34 +02:00
Óscar González Fernández
91f1e0e97d
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Removing Bean sufix to data classes. To avoid name collisions with the components of the same name, Component is appended.
2009-07-20 21:30:25 +02:00
Óscar González Fernández
55cede5979
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Moving some classes to new package in order to highlight their role.
2009-07-20 21:25:59 +02:00
Óscar González Fernández
53805f7509
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: The scrolls are relocated when a tasklist is loaded, instead of when the window is loaded.
...
This way it's kept previous behaviour in demo page and in the scheduling view the scrollbars are viewed correctly.
2009-07-20 21:22:23 +02:00
Óscar González Fernández
ca21278707
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Fixing dependencies visualization errors in order view.
2009-07-20 21:15:21 +02:00
Óscar González Fernández
689de93b24
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Changing the adapter so changes applied in the planner are written to the corresponding TaskElement.
2009-07-20 18:15:44 +02:00
Óscar González Fernández
b9f13d3457
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Adding save command that will save the changes done to the tasks elements.
2009-07-20 18:08:43 +02:00
Óscar González Fernández
df7be5d6ac
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Arrow down in last row, creates a new file in the default planner.
2009-07-20 17:58:30 +02:00
Óscar González Fernández
36e51de76c
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Previous functionality of adding task is now set up using commands support.
2009-07-20 17:48:06 +02:00
Óscar González Fernández
fc12eccb9e
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Adding support for defining and adding commands to the planner.
2009-07-20 17:36:31 +02:00
Óscar González Fernández
0c459b2502
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: ListDetails renamed to LeftTasksTree and TaskDetail renamed to LeftTasksTreeRow.
2009-07-20 17:20:48 +02:00
Óscar González Fernández
5a7c6686d2
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: The adapter is moved to a top level class managed by Spring to allow the posibility of using reatachments.
...
Changes are still not saved.
2009-07-20 12:58:42 +02:00
Óscar González Fernández
3c41301d10
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Adding methods addDependency and canAddDependency to IAdapterToTaskFundamentalProperties.
2009-07-19 20:08:17 +02:00
Óscar González Fernández
f80c09dc76
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Fixing dependenciesWithThisOrigin association cascade value.
...
Associated test is also changed in a convoluted way so the error is reproduced.
2009-07-19 19:51:47 +02:00
Óscar González Fernández
04b6d76e0d
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Fixing error. addVisibilityPropertiesChangeListener must be called for both source and destination.
2009-07-19 19:40:29 +02:00
Manuel Rego Casasnovas
e9bd396f33
ItEr17S13CUConfiguracionDeOrganizacionsDeTraballoConUnidadesTraballoItEr15S11: Fixed the problem with the header of the HoursGroup list when editing an OrderElement.
2009-07-19 19:29:57 +02:00
Manuel Rego Casasnovas
c52e1c2afd
ItEr17S06XestionDaComunidadeItEr16S08: Added license info (AGPLv3).
2009-07-19 19:04:07 +02:00
Diego Pino Garcia
080b2a4592
ItEr17S12CUAltaTipoParteDeTraballo: Fixed WorkReport tests
2009-07-19 18:46:52 +02:00
Manuel Rego Casasnovas
c907bf24c6
ItEr17S14CUListadoTiposPartesTraballo: Added basic support for CRUD operations over a WorkReportType.
...
Javier Moran Rua <jmoran@igalia.com>: Added the option to access to WorkReportType CRUD operations in
CustomMenuController
2009-07-19 18:29:08 +02:00
Óscar González Fernández
9e87a571fb
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: After scheduling, a redirection is made to schdule view.
2009-07-19 12:50:09 +02:00
Óscar González Fernández
74b3ba3f55
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Renaming DependencyRegistry to GanntDiagramGraph.
2009-07-19 12:45:56 +02:00
Óscar González Fernández
c821902fa1
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Simple adaptation of TaskElements to the planner.
...
Javier Moran Rua <jmoran@igalia.com>: Removed
navalplanner-webapp/src/main/java/org/navalplanner/web/orders/OrderPlanningModel.java, not necessary.
2009-07-19 12:09:18 +02:00
Óscar González Fernández
062e7319f6
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Adding method to retrieve the associated TaskElement to an Order.
2009-07-19 11:49:44 +02:00
Óscar González Fernández
4a7568fcec
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Adding abstract methods getChildren and isLeaf to Task.
2009-07-19 11:39:07 +02:00
Óscar González Fernández
c632841197
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Preparing the landing page for scheduling orders.
2009-07-19 11:05:16 +02:00
Óscar González Fernández
c15a93229e
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Refactoring Planner so it doesn't send exceptions when the configuration is still not ready.
2009-07-18 22:37:00 +02:00
Óscar González Fernández
697ec9ff54
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Refactoring current model so it can work with another subyacent domain.
2009-07-18 20:32:30 +02:00
Óscar González Fernández
137c5f4d8d
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Extracting fundamental properties part of TaskBean so it can be parametrized.
2009-07-18 19:54:26 +02:00
Óscar González Fernández
8c1ba7e80e
ItEr17S10CUCreacionProxectoPlanificacionItEr16S12: Creating TaskLeafBean so the hierarchy is cleaner.
2009-07-18 19:30:11 +02:00
Manuel Rego Casasnovas
3a6597b610
ItEr17S12CUAltaTipoParteDeTraballo: Using new macro compnent TwoWaySelector for the OrderElement edit window.
2009-07-18 18:59:46 +02:00
Manuel Rego Casasnovas
cdd8560676
ItEr17S12CUAltaTipoParteDeTraballo: Creating a macro component called TwoWaySelector.
2009-07-18 18:31:35 +02:00
Diego Pino Garcia
1d7532d759
ItEr17S12CUAltaTipoParteDeTraballo: Create entities for WorkReports
2009-07-15 13:03:56 +02:00